Randall’s Island Events
Throughout the year, RIPA hosts over 300 free public events including tours, movie nights, waterfront activities, our annual Earth Day and Harvest Festivals and more. These family-friendly drop-in events play an integral role in helping Park visitors explore the Island’s varied points of interest. We strive to host inclusive, accessible events that enable all individuals to engage fully. Team RIVER Volunteers
Volunteer with Team RIVER (Randall’s Island Volunteer Ecological Restorers) and help keep Randall’s Island Park beautiful! Team RIVER Volunteers regularly work with the Natural Areas team twice a month to take care of and restore our natural spaces on the island.
